To solve this, we analyze each tape diagram:
Step 1: Analyze the first tape diagram
The first tape diagram has 5 segments, each labeled \( x + 4 \), and the total is 44. So the equation would be \( 5(x + 4)=44 \). Let's expand this: \( 5x + 20 = 44 \), which simplifies to \( 5x=24 \), so \( x = \frac{24}{5}=4.8 \). But we need to check the other diagrams too.
Step 2: Analyze the second tape diagram
The second tape diagram has 5 segments of \( x \) and one segment of 4, with total 44. The equation would be \( 5x + 4 = 44 \). Solving this: \( 5x=44 - 4=40 \), so \( x = 8 \).
Step 3: Analyze the third tape diagram
The third tape diagram has 4 segments of \( x \) and one segment of 5, with total 44. The equation would be \( 4x+5 = 44 \). Solving this: \( 4x=44 - 5 = 39 \), so \( x=\frac{39}{4}=9.75 \).
Since the problem is about choosing the correct tape diagram and equation, we assume the context where the second diagram (with 5 \( x \)s and a 4) is correct. The equation for the second diagram is \( 5x + 4 = 44 \).
